Collocations of incipient

incipient stage
Frequency: 80 %

The project is still in its incipient stage.

incipient problem
Frequency: 70 %

Addressing the incipient problem now will prevent bigger issues later.

incipient disease
Frequency: 65 %

The doctor caught the incipient disease early.

incipient relationship
Frequency: 60 %

Their incipient relationship was still fragile but promising.

incipient talent
Frequency: 50 %

Her incipient talent for painting was evident from a young age.
